The Strange Child (World Premiere)


The Strange Child takes place in a bucolic village, where the lives of siblings Christlieb and Felix are upended by the arrival of two strangers: a cruel tutor named Master Inkblot, and a mysterious sprite who lives in the woods. Weird and magical happenings culminate in a violent struggle in which imagination itself is at stake.”

June 17th and 18th, 2022 with Kamatrōn and Quince Ensembles in Pittsburgh, PA.
